Yeah T2 and T1 work just fine on the same machine, especially on a mac. I just have a folder in my Applications folder called Tracktion, and I have virtually every build of Tracktion still in there. Just launch the one you wish to use. Easy.
And the freezing cursor bug should be fixed. I haven't had it for quite a while now so I can't remember exactly when it was sorted.
